Priest School movie poster

Priest School

8.0/10

Movie Overview

Documentary providing rare access to the inner workings, personnel, seminarians and history of the oldest Scottish institution abroad - Il Pontificio College Scozzese (The Scots College in Rome.)

Cast

Related Movies